OP, you will need to force it into Recovery mode. 1)Hold Power button until you see "Slide to power off" and slide it 2) After power down, hold the Home Button (only physical button on face of iPod Touch) and plug into iTunes. Keep hold the button till you see a iTunes Logo and USB cord.
